Pros

  • Affirm anticipates robust full-year earnings growth of 560% to $0.99 per share.
  • Recent quarterly results showed EPS of $0.23 beating consensus by $0.12 with revenue up 33.6%.
  • Analysts maintain Moderate Buy consensus with average price target of $89.17.

Considerations

  • Stock trades at elevated forward P/E of 82.63 versus industry average of 24.48.
  • Significant insider selling totalling over $57 million in past three months.
  • High beta of 3.57 exposes shares to substantial market volatility.
